Katie Price has broken her silence with shocking news about her missing husband, Lee Andrews — claiming she has “found” him alive and being held in a prison in Dubai, accused of espionage.
For more than a week, fans and friends had feared the worst after Lee vanished, failing to appear on Good Morning Britain as planned. Rumors had swirled that he was under a strict travel ban, and speculation of kidnapping circulated online. Katie, however, insists she now has confirmation that he is safe.
“I have found him. He is alive, and he is ok,” Katie told The Sun, describing a brief but emotional two-minute phone call with Lee this morning. “I told him how worried I had been and told him I loved him.”
The call, she added, was “very rushed,” with Lee reportedly telling her: “The authorities out there think I’m a spy.” Beyond this, Katie said she had no further details to share.
The couple, who tied the knot in a whirlwind Dubai wedding this February, has faced intense media scrutiny throughout Lee’s disappearance. Katie’s concern has been visible to fans, including her touching gesture earlier this week of recording a love song in hopes of “bringing Lee home.”
UK authorities have clarified they are not involved in the search. Hertfordshire Police confirmed to The Mirror: “We’d like to clarify that Hertfordshire Constabulary received a report in March. However, once it was established that the alleged offences happened in Dubai, we referred this case to the relevant authorities as this was outside of our jurisdiction.”
